excel怎么统计筛选出来的行数据

excel怎么统计筛选出来的行数据

在Excel中,统计筛选出来的行数据的方法有多种,主要包括使用SUBTOTAL函数、使用筛选和高级筛选功能、以及利用表格工具和数据透视表。 其中,SUBTOTAL函数是最常用的方法之一,因为它可以根据不同的统计需求执行多种操作,如求和、计数、平均值等。接下来,我将详细介绍如何使用这些方法来统计筛选出来的行数据。

一、使用SUBTOTAL函数

1.1 SUBTOTAL函数简介

SUBTOTAL函数是Excel中一个非常强大的函数,它允许用户在筛选数据时对可见行进行统计。与其他函数不同,SUBTOTAL函数可以自动忽略被隐藏的行,包括通过筛选隐藏的行。

1.2 SUBTOTAL函数的语法

SUBTOTAL函数的语法为:SUBTOTAL(function_num, ref1, [ref2], ...),其中,function_num表示要执行的计算类型。例如,9表示求和,1表示求平均值,3表示计数等。ref1ref2等则是要进行统计的范围。

1.3 SUBTOTAL函数的使用示例

假设我们有一张包含销售数据的表格,我们可以使用SUBTOTAL函数对筛选后的数据进行统计。以下是具体步骤:

  1. 插入筛选器:选择数据区域,点击“数据”选项卡,选择“筛选”按钮。
  2. 应用筛选条件:使用筛选器筛选出符合条件的数据行。
  3. 使用SUBTOTAL函数:在表格下方插入一个单元格,输入公式=SUBTOTAL(9, B2:B100),其中9表示求和,B2:B100是要统计的数据范围。这样,公式会自动对筛选后的可见行进行求和。

二、使用筛选和高级筛选功能

2.1 筛选功能

Excel的筛选功能可以帮助用户快速筛选数据,并且在筛选后,用户可以对可见数据行进行各种统计操作。

2.2 高级筛选功能

Excel的高级筛选功能允许用户使用复杂的条件进行筛选。高级筛选功能不仅可以筛选数据,还可以将筛选结果复制到其他位置,以便进一步分析和统计。

2.3 筛选和高级筛选的使用示例

假设我们有一张包含销售数据的表格,我们可以使用筛选和高级筛选功能对数据进行筛选和统计。以下是具体步骤:

  1. 插入筛选器:选择数据区域,点击“数据”选项卡,选择“筛选”按钮。
  2. 应用筛选条件:使用筛选器筛选出符合条件的数据行。
  3. 统计筛选结果:在筛选结果中使用SUM、AVERAGE、COUNT等函数对可见行进行统计。

三、利用表格工具

3.1 表格工具简介

Excel中的表格工具允许用户将数据转换为表格格式,并自动添加筛选器和汇总行。表格工具可以帮助用户更方便地对筛选后的数据进行统计。

3.2 表格工具的使用示例

假设我们有一张包含销售数据的表格,我们可以使用表格工具对数据进行筛选和统计。以下是具体步骤:

  1. 将数据转换为表格:选择数据区域,点击“插入”选项卡,选择“表格”按钮。
  2. 插入汇总行:在表格右下角,点击“汇总行”按钮,Excel会自动添加一行用于统计筛选后的数据。
  3. 应用筛选条件:使用表格中的筛选器筛选出符合条件的数据行。
  4. 统计筛选结果:在汇总行中选择相应的统计类型(如求和、平均值、计数等),Excel会自动对筛选后的可见行进行统计。

四、使用数据透视表

4.1 数据透视表简介

数据透视表是Excel中非常强大的数据分析工具,允许用户对大量数据进行汇总、分析和统计。数据透视表可以根据用户的需求灵活地筛选和统计数据。

4.2 数据透视表的使用示例

假设我们有一张包含销售数据的表格,我们可以使用数据透视表对数据进行筛选和统计。以下是具体步骤:

  1. 插入数据透视表:选择数据区域,点击“插入”选项卡,选择“数据透视表”按钮。
  2. 设置数据透视表字段:将需要分析的数据字段拖动到行标签、列标签和值标签区域中。
  3. 应用筛选条件:在数据透视表中使用筛选器筛选出符合条件的数据行。
  4. 统计筛选结果:数据透视表会自动对筛选后的数据进行统计,并显示在表格中。

通过上述方法,用户可以方便地对Excel中筛选出来的行数据进行统计。无论是使用SUBTOTAL函数、筛选和高级筛选功能、表格工具,还是数据透视表,都可以帮助用户更高效地进行数据分析和统计。

相关问答FAQs:

1. 如何在Excel中统计筛选后的行数据?

答:在Excel中,您可以使用“筛选”功能来筛选出所需的行数据。一旦筛选完成,您可以使用以下方法来统计筛选后的行数据:

  • 使用SUM函数:如果筛选后的行数据是数字类型,您可以在需要统计的列中使用SUM函数来计算总和。只需在单元格中输入“=SUM(筛选后的数据区域)”即可。

  • 使用COUNT函数:如果您只想知道筛选后的行数据的数量,您可以在需要统计的列中使用COUNT函数。只需在单元格中输入“=COUNT(筛选后的数据区域)”即可。

  • 使用AVERAGE函数:如果您想计算筛选后的行数据的平均值,可以使用AVERAGE函数。只需在单元格中输入“=AVERAGE(筛选后的数据区域)”即可。

请注意,在使用这些函数时,确保引用的是筛选后的数据区域,而不是整个列。这样,您就可以准确地统计筛选后的行数据。

2. 我如何在Excel中统计筛选出来的行数据的最大值和最小值?

答:在Excel中,您可以使用以下方法来统计筛选后的行数据的最大值和最小值:

  • 使用MAX函数:如果筛选后的行数据是数字类型,您可以在需要统计的列中使用MAX函数来找到最大值。只需在单元格中输入“=MAX(筛选后的数据区域)”即可。

  • 使用MIN函数:同样地,如果您想找到筛选后的行数据的最小值,可以使用MIN函数。只需在单元格中输入“=MIN(筛选后的数据区域)”即可。

这些函数将会自动计算筛选后的行数据的最大值和最小值,并在相应的单元格中显示结果。请确保引用的是筛选后的数据区域,以获得准确的结果。

3. 如何在Excel中统计筛选出来的行数据的不同值的个数?

答:如果您想知道筛选后的行数据中有多少个不同的值,您可以使用Excel中的“高级筛选”功能来实现。

  1. 首先,在您的数据区域上方插入一个新的行,并在该行中输入列标题。
  2. 选择您的数据区域,然后点击“数据”选项卡上的“高级”按钮。
  3. 在“高级筛选”对话框中,选择“复制到其他位置”选项,并将“筛选到”区域指定为新插入的行。
  4. 在“条件区域”中选择包含原始数据的整个区域。
  5. 点击“确定”按钮执行高级筛选。

完成上述步骤后,您将在新插入的行中看到筛选后的数据,其中不同值的个数将会显示在相应的单元格中。这样,您就可以轻松统计筛选后的行数据中不同值的个数。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/3974849

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部